How much do director of growth strategy j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average yearly pay for director of growth strategy in the United States is $139,100.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$117,500.00 and $145,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a director of growth strategy?

A Director of Growth Strategy is a senior leader responsible for developing and executing strategies to drive business growth and expansion. This role involves analyzing market trends, identifying new business opportunities,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to implement growth initiatives. Directors of Growth Strategy often work closely with marketing, sales, product, and finance departments to align goals and measure the effectiveness of growth plans. Their main objective is to ensure the company achieves sustainable and scalable growth.

How does a director of growth strategy typically collaborate with cross-functional teams to drive company objectives?

A Director of Growth Strategy works closely with departments such as marketing, sales, product, and analytics to identify and prioritize growth opportunities. They facilitate regular strategy sessions, align teams on key performance indicators, and ensure initiatives are supported by data-driven insights. Effective communication and project management skills are essential, as the director often leads cross-departmental projects to test and scale new growth channels. This collaborative environment also provides exposure to various business functions, supporting both professional development and company-wide impact.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a director of growth strategy,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Director of Growth Strategy, you need expertise in strategic planning, data analysis, market research, and business development, typically backed by a degree in business, marketing, or a related field. Familiarity with analytics platforms (e.g., Google Analytics), CRM systems, and growth marketing tools is crucial, along with experience in A/B testing and financial modeling. Exceptional le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ills help drive cross-functional alignment and inspire teams toward ambitious growth targets. These capabilities are essential for identifying opportunities, optimizing strategies, and achieving sustainable business expansion.

What is the difference between Director Of Growth Strategy vs Business Development Manager?

AspectDirector Of Growth StrategyBusiness Development Manager
CredentialsTypically requires a bachelor's degree in business, marketing, or related field; often an MBA; strong analytical skillsUsually holds a bachelor's degree; experience in sales or marketing preferred
Work EnvironmentStrategic planning, cross-department collaboration, executive meetingsClient meetings, sales pitches, partnership negotiations
Industry UsageCommon in tech, SaaS, and large corporations focusing on growth initiativesWidely used in sales-driven industries, startups, and mid-sized companies

The main difference is that the Director Of Growth Strategy focuses on high-level strategic planning to drive overall company growth, while a Business Development Manager concentrates on building relationships and closing deals to generate revenue. Both roles require strong communication skills and industry knowledge, but their scope and focus differ significantly.
